Mission

To build a next generational IDS/IPS engine which will remain free of use by any individual or organization. OISF will maintain and develop this software while providing training and support to its users.

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2024, the highest total compensation at Open Information Security Foundation equaled 14% of the organization's total expenses. The median for science & technology organizations is 9%.

This organization (2024)
14%
Sector median
9%
Middle half of sector
4% to 21%

Based on 1,078 science & technology organ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

What does the Board Secretary of Open Information Security Foundation earn?

In 2024, the Board Secretary of Open Information Security Foundation received $189,103 in total compensation. This pay is in the top 10% for Board Secretary roles among n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ors: at least 9 in 10 comparable filings report less. Based on IRS Form 990 data.

How does Board Secretary pay at Open Information Security Foundation compare with similar nonprofits?

Compared with the same role at nonprofits nationwide, across all sectors, the 2024 pay of the Board Secretary at Open Information Security Foundation falls in the top 10%. In 2024, the highest total compensation at Open Information Security Foundation equaled 14% of the organization's total expenses. The median for science & technology organizations is 9%.

What are Open Information Security Foundation's revenue and expenses?

In 2024, Open Information Security Foundation reported $1.5M in total revenue and $1.3M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
